Various Recordings, Hollywood, Los Angeles, CA early 1968
Vintage Masters presents a rare collection of recordings by the Monkees, who emerged as a rival to the Beatles in the 1960s in America!
This collection includes rare acetate recordings and alternate takes, primarily from the soundtrack of the 1968 film "Head" and previously unreleased tracks from the album "Instant Replay" released that same year.
